As we trace the slow but steady progress of the 2012 McLaren MP4-12C to market, today brings a milestone: the start of regular production in the company's Technology Centre (MTC).

Full series production will take place at the not-yet-completed McLaren Production Center (MPC), but the first batch of cars will be built under the tight controls and watchful eyes of McLaren's best.

The MPC is due to enter operation in May, and is where the bulk of the 1,000 MP4-12Cs are to be built in 2011.

In case you've forgotten, the MP4-12C uses an innovative carbon fiber monocoque chassis tub, a potent 600-horsepower 3.8-liter V-8 turbocharged engine, and some of the purest motorsports-derived electronic controls to ever hit the street.

The first deliveries should begin soon, with U.S. sales gearing up through the recently-established dealer network.
